Course Details
• Engineering Communication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of effective communication in an engineering context, including key terms, industry-specific jargon, and technical writing principles.
• Global Communication Strategies: Techniques for adapting communication styles to diverse cultural backgrounds and international settings, emphasizing clear and respectful communication.
• Effective Email and Report Writing: Best practices for writing clear, concise, and professional emails and reports, including formatting, tone, and structure.
• Presentation Skills for Engineers: Techniques for delivering effective presentations to technical and non-technical audiences, including slide design, public speaking, and storytelling.
• Cross-Functional Collaboration: Strategies for working effectively with colleagues from other departments and functions, including clear communication, active listening, and conflict resolution.
• Project Management Communication: Techniques for managing communication within engineering projects, including project planning, status reporting, and stakeholder management.
• Data Visualization and Technical Graphics: Principles and best practices for creating effective data visualizations and technical graphics, including chart selection, color theory, and visual hierarchy.
• Negotiation and Conflict Resolution: Strategies for negotiating and resolving conflicts in engineering contexts, including effective communication, active listening, and problem-solving.
